Spongebob's Buff Millennium Scale Meme

This meme uses the popular 'Spongebob Squarepants getting progressively more muscular' template to humorously emphasize that four different time-related phrases all refer to the exact same duration: 1000 years. Each panel pairs a version of Spongebob with increasing physical intensity with a term for 1000 years:
1. Top panel: A cheerful, regular Spongebob with the text '1000 years'
2. Second panel: A stern, slightly tense Spongebob with '100 decades' (100 decades = 100 * 10 = 1000 years)
3. Third panel: A highly muscular, flexing Spongebob with '10 century's' (a grammatically incorrect phrase, intended to mean 10 centuries = 10 * 100 = 1000 years)
4. Bottom panel: An extremely buff, rock-like Spongebob with 'A MILLENIUM' (a typo of 'millennium', the formal term for 1000 years). The joke lies in the visual escalation matching the perceived 'weight' of the terminology, even though all phrases describe the same length of time, while also poking fun at minor grammar/typo errors in the phrasing.

Origin notes

This meme is a remix of the widely used 'Spongebob Buff Evolution' template, which originates from edited scenes of the Spongebob Squarepants animated television series. The template is commonly shared on meme platforms like Imgur, Reddit, and Twitter/X to convey increasing intensity or emphasis on a shared point. The image includes an 'imgflip.com' watermark at the bottom left, indicating it was likely created or shared using the Imgflip meme maker tool. The template itself edits Spongebob's appearance to show progressive muscular growth, a trope used to highlight growing significance or hype around a concept.
